What are remote jobs that use QuickBooks?

Remote QuickBooks jobs involve providing bookkeeping or accounting services using either a desktop or cloud-based version of Intuit QuickBooks software. In these work from home positions, you may prepare and send invoices, track and record expenses, manage payroll activities, and perform data entry tasks related to a company or client’s finances. You handle your duties online and communicate with your client or employer via email, chat, or telephone. If you work from home as an accountant who uses QuickBooks, you audit a company’s finances and find areas for improvement.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ote QuickBooks specialist?

To excel as a Remote QuickBooks Specialist, you need a solid understanding of accounting principles, experience with bookkeeping, and proficiency in QuickBooks software, often supported by a relevant degree or certification. Familiarity with cloud-based accounting systems, QuickBooks Online, and tools like Excel or integrated payroll applications is typically required. Strong attention to detail, time management, and effective communication skills help manage client relationships and ensure accuracy in remote work settings. These skills are crucial for maintaining accurate financial records, meeting deadlines, and delivering reliable support to clients from a distance.

How does a remote QuickBooks specialist typically collaborate with clients and team members to ensure accurate bookkeeping?

As a Remote QuickBooks specialist, you’ll frequently communicate with clients and internal teams using email, video calls, and project management software to gather financial data, clarify transactions, and resolve discrepancies. Collaboration is key, as you may coordinate with accountants, payroll staff, or business owners to reconcile accounts, generate reports, and implement best practices. Proactive communication, strong organizational skills, and the ability to work independently are essential for success in this remote role.

What is a remote QuickBooks specialist?

A Remote QuickBooks Specialist is a professional who manages accounting and bookkeeping tasks using QuickBooks software while working from a remote location. They help businesses with tasks like recording transactions, reconciling accounts, generating financial reports, and ensuring compliance with accounting standards. By working remotely, these specialists offer flexibility and often serve multiple clients, ranging from small businesses to larger organizations. Their expertise helps companies keep their finances organized and up to date without needing an on-site accountant.

Job description

Work with a Top 20 CPA and advisory firm that Accounts for Anything.  Aprio has 40 U.S. office locations, as well as international office locations and more than 3,200 team members that speak 60+ languages across the globe.  By bringing together proven expertise, deep understanding, and strategic foresight for fast-growing industries, Aprio ensures clients are prepared for wherever life or business may take them. Discover a top-rated culture, vast growth opportunities and your next big career move with Aprio.

Join Aprio's Technology Client Accounting Services team and you will help fast-growing technology and ecommerce companies build the financial foundation they need to scale. Aprio Advisory Group, LLC is a progressive, fast-growing firm looking for a tech-savvy, detail-driven Senior Associate to join our dynamic, distributed team. 
 
Position Responsibilities:
  • Serve as a primary point of contact for a portfolio of technology and ecommerce clients. 
  • Own and coordinate weekly accounting activities and month-end close, ensuring reconciliations are completed accurately and on time by the engagement team. 
  • Complete initial reviews of team work and meet with clients to walk through monthly reporting.
  • Review client current and future state, diagnose errors, and recommend fixes for both prior periods and going forward.
  • Document processes and maintain strong working knowledge of accounting systems and their integrations.
  • Support and mentor junior and offshore team members as part of a knowledge-sharing team.
  • Identify opportunities to improve client workflows through automation and better tooling. 
Qualifications:
  • Adept with modern accounting technology and how it is used to automate close and reporting.
  • Proficient with QuickBooks Online and NetSuite. Experience with Ramp, Bill.com, Gusto preferred.
  • Experience serving technology, ecommerce, or fast-growth startup clients preferred.
  • Strong project management mindset with the ability to manage multiple clients with consistency.
  • Able to work independently, manage competing priorities, and hit deadlines.
  • Comfortable and effective working in a distributed, remote team environment.
  • Proficient in the Microsoft Office Suite, with strong Excel and Adobe Acrobat sk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Team-oriented and flexible. 
Education and Experience:
  • 3+ years of experience in a client-facing accounting role, with strong knowledge of financials, general ledger, journal entries, and account reconciliation.
  • Experience with technology or ecommerce clients preferred.
  • Bachelor's degree in accounting, business, or a related field required.
  • CPA preferred but not required.
